Understanding Replacement Windows and What the Service Entails
Modern window systems refer to the method of removing existing window structures and glass panels and installing new, purpose-built units in their place. Unlike a complete structural replacement, typical installations use an insert method that fits within the current wall structure, minimizing disruption substantially. All replacement windows gets precision-cut to fit the opening without affecting the surrounding wall.
Mechanically, modern windows operate using dual or triple panes of tempered or low-E coated glass divided with insulating gas fills that prevent energy loss. Window frame construction come in a range of durable materials — each providing its own combination of performance durability and aesthetics. Hardware components like weatherstripping seals further enhance both security and comfort.
The difference with expert windows replacement services stand out is the attention to detail in fitting. Even a small gap between the frame and wall can allow moisture infiltration that defeat the purpose of upgrading. Our team uses digital measurement systems and works to building code requirements to make certain each window meets performance expectations.

How Our Window Replacement Works
- In-Home Evaluation — A Golden State Builders Group specialist visits your home to evaluate current conditions. We look at structural integrity, glass performance and individual priorities you have noted. The consultation results in a written proposal that outlines materials, timeline, and cost.
- Product Selection and Customization — Guided by your preferences, we help you choose the right frame material, glass type, and style. Choices range from single-hung, double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ows in several durable frame materials. Each opening is re-measured before products ship.
- Getting Your Home Ready — Before any work begins, our team lays down protective coverings to protect interior surfaces. Interior items close to work zones gets shifted out of the way and outdoor features by the work area are protected as needed.
- Extracting and Disposing of Prior Windows — Existing units come out systematically following a methodical sequence to protect the rough opening structure. Any damaged wood discovered during removal is addressed before installation continues to provide proper structural support.
- Setting and Securing the New Systems — Every replacement unit gets set precisely and aligned using professional layout tools. Screws and anchors are set according to installation guidelines, and flexible insulation materials is packed into the frame cavity to prevent drafts.
- Flashing, Sealing, and Weatherproofing — Waterproof wrap covers all transition points to direct water away. Weatherproof beads are run along all exterior seams using UV-stable and paintable caulk.
- Quality Check and Client Review — Every installed window is tested for operation, seal, and appearance. Our team reviews the results with you before we leave. All debris, packaging, and removed materials leave the property with our crew.

Common Questions Homeowners Ask About Windows Projects
How much time will the installation take?The average whole-home windows replacement takes between a few hours to a full day per window, depending on project scope and accessibility. Replacing all windows throughout a house at scale could run three to five days of work. We always give a detailed timeline at the planning meeting so the project fits your life.
Are replacement windows a painful or highly disruptive process?Unlike major structural renovations, windows work is contained and organized. Spaces where windows are being replaced could see temporary moments of open exposure to outside air as old units are removed and new ones installed. The installation team moves methodically through each opening to keep your day as normal as possible.
What should I budget for windows installation?Window replacement costs are influenced by how many units you're replacing and what features they include. Rough pricing for residential replacement windows range from about $400 to $1,200 per window installed. We supply itemized quotes after an in-home consultation so pricing is fully clear before any work is scheduled.
When will I need to replace them again?High-quality replacement windows are built to last for 20 to 40 years with routine cleaning and inspection. Premium frame materials resist fading, warping, and corrosion far longer than older single-pane units. The service life of each unit is affected by multiple factors including exposure and care.
Do new windows really save on energy bills?Absolutely, and the financial benefit are one of the most commonly reported benefits of completing a professional window installation. Homeowners with single-pane or failed-seal windows commonly notice improvements in monthly HVAC costs of 15 to 30 percent after installing energy-efficient replacement windows. Specific numbers vary by the scope of the upgrade and climate patterns.
